Harry "Hank" Ranft Obituary
Harry J. "Hank" Ranft, 78, of Indianapolis, passed away December 13, 2017. He was born March 1, 1939 in Brooklyn, New York to the late Henry C. and Marion (Straney) Ranft. Harry was a long time member of Immaculate Heart of Mary Catholic Church... Read Harry "Hank" Ranft's Obituary
